Penha de Águia
Penha de Águia is a peak in Maçainhas, Belmonte, Castelo Branco District and has an elevation of 687 metres. Penha de Águia is situated nearby to the village Maçainhas, as well as near the hamlet Quinta Cimeira.Places of Interest

Centum Cellas, also referred to as Centum Cellæ, Centum Celli, or Centum Cœli, is a Roman villa rustica that dates back to the 1st century AD, located in the Mount of Santo Antão in Belmonte, Castelo Branco District, Portugal.
